The Big Question: How Many Calories in Costco Carrot Cake?
Alright, let's get down to business. You've been wondering, "How many calories are in a slice of Costco carrot cake?" Well, brace yourselves, my friends. A single serving (which is a generous 1/12th of the cake) clocks in at around 560 calories.

Breaking Down the Calories
Let's break down those calories to make them a little less daunting. Here's the approximate nutritional info for one serving:
- Calories: 560 - Total Fat: 30g (46% DV) - Saturated Fat: 16g (80% DV) - Cholesterol: 95mg (32% DV) - Sodium: 350mg (15% DV) - Total Carbohydrate: 75g (25% DV) - Dietary Fiber: 2g (8% DV) - Total Sugars: 50g - Protein: 5g

Size Matters: Costco Carrot Cake Servings
One of the reasons the calories can seem so high is because of the cake's size. Costco's carrot cake is a whopping 3.5 pounds, which is enough to serve 12 people.
